What struck us most during our evaluation was the bearing material composition. The tri-metal construction features a steel backing layer for strength, a copper-lead intermediate layer for load distribution, and a specialized overlay coating that provides excellent conformability and wear resistance. This engineering approach mirrors OEM specifications, which is critical for maintaining proper oil clearances and ensuring adequate lubrication under extreme operating conditions.

Advanced Bearing Technology
During our examination, we noted several advanced features that set this bearing kit apart from budget alternatives. The overlay coating provides excellent embedability, meaning it can absorb microscopic debris particles that inevitably make their way into engine oil. This characteristic protects the crankshaft journal surfaces from scoring and premature wear—a feature we’ve seen fail in cheaper bearing sets.
The copper-lead intermediate layer provides excellent heat dissipation, crucial for high-performance or high-mileage applications where thermal stress can cause bearing failure. Our Installation Experience and Professional Tips
We’ve installed this bearing kit in multiple engine rebuilds, and the experience has been consistently positive. The bearings arrive individually packaged with protective coating, and we recommend leaving this coating in place until immediately before installation to prevent oxidation or contamination.
During installation, we followed standard engine building practices, and the bearings seated perfectly in their bores with proper crush. The oil clearances measured exactly where they should be—between 0.0008″ and 0.0024″ for main bearings, and 0.0012″ to 0.0028″ for rod bearings, depending on journal condition. These clearances are critical for proper oil film thickness and engine longevity.
Professional Installation Insights: Always verify oil clearances using Plastigage or a dial bore gauge before final assembly. Clean all bearing surfaces thoroughly with brake cleaner and lint-free cloths. Apply a thin coating of assembly lube to bearing surfaces before installation—never use thick grease which can block oil passages during initial startup. Torque all main caps and rod bolts to manufacturer specifications using a calibrated torque wrench, following the proper sequence.

Why Engine Bearings Fail and When to Replace Them
Understanding bearing failure helps appreciate the quality of this replacement kit. During our years of engine rebuilding, we’ve identified the most common bearing failure modes: oil starvation (often from clogged oil passages or failed oil pumps), contamination (metal particles or dirt in the oil), improper installation (incorrect torque or clearances), and simple wear from high mileage.
We recommend bearing replacement if you experience any of these symptoms: knocking noise that increases with engine speed, especially under load; significant oil pressure loss; metallic debris in engine oil during changes; or if you’re rebuilding an engine that’s exceeded 150,000 miles. Addressing bearing wear before complete failure prevents catastrophic engine damage that can destroy crankshafts, connecting rods, and engine blocks.
